Ice Ages Without Ice
January 25, 2009
Add Review/Comment
On Sunday, January 25, join Curator of Paleontology Eric Scott for a lecture, “Ice Ages Without Ice: Pleistocene Fossils from Inland Southern California,” at 2pm at the San Bernardino County Museum. This program is free with museum admission. “Saying ‘Ice Ages’ conjures images of glaciers, ice fields, and herds of woolly mammoths huddling against raging blizzards,” said Scott. “Those scenarios are engaging, but they don’t accurately portray what our region was like during glacial times.” During the Pleistocene Epoch—the “Ice Ages”— inland southern California summers were cooler and year-round temperatures were more moderate. Snow and ice were present for most of the year in the local mountains. “We had streams and lake in the valleys, fed by mountain ice, which provided lots of sustenance for plants and animals in the valleys. The evidence of these ancient organisms lies right beneath your feet.” continued Scott. In his lecture, Scott will talk about Pleistocene fossils from throughout southern California, with special emphasis on the Rancho La Brea “tar pits” in Los Angeles as well as more local sites. Visitors will also get a glimpse at the exhibits of Pleistocene fossils planned for the museum’s upcoming Hall of Geological Wonders.
